Nine #1 hits. 50+ dates per year. Adam Hawley has burst on to the scene as a celebrated and innovative artist, composer and band leader. Originally signed to Maurice White’s (founder of Earth, Wind, & Fire) label Kalimba Music, Adam’s first two albums “Double Vision” and “Just the Beginning” spawned an incredible Six #1 Hits, an unprecedented feat for a new artist. He followed that up with “Escape” which included the 2020 Billboard Song Of The Year “To The Top.” Now totaling 9 # 1’s, Adam sets out with this exciting fourth album “Risin’ Up” which features Steve Cole, Vincent Ingala, Julian Vaughn, Riley Richard & Kat Hawley anchored by the thrilling first single “Risin’ Up.”

Jimi Hendrix was playing as Jimmy James…

when Willie (Bill) Magee met, befriended and eventually joined up with Hendrix to form the band “Jimmy James and the Flames.” In 1967, Hendrix went to England, and Magee took his newly formed band, the “Kansas City Playboys” on a tour around Europe.

The rest is history…now after a brief hiatus Bill Magee has felt the pull of the blues once again and come out of retirement. Catch a performance of his and see the best of Southern Blues music.

Nowadays, Bill Magee is one of San Diego, California’s busiest working musicians. He can be seen around the greater San Diego Area on a regular basis and throughout the Southwest and beyond!

Randi Driscoll

Randi Driscoll is an award winning singer/songwriter and actress. Randi’s original music is a blend of piano driven singer/songwriter music with elements of pop, country and jazz. Her music has been featured in film, television, and a commercial directed by Spike Lee, in which Randi also appeared. Her performance credits include appearances at Lincoln Center, Place des Arts (Montreal), The Japan Center for the Arts, The Ford Theatre and numerous universities, performance halls, nightclubs and cabarets.

Randi studied theatre and music at the University of San Diego, and her theatrical credits include most recently appearing alongside Bradley Whitford and Mary McDonnell in the Broad Stage’s “Laramie Project; Epilogue” (Romaine Patterson). Randi has appeared in several San Diego film and stage productions, and has worked as a teaching artist and director for San Diego Junior Theatre, CYT,  The Musician’s Institute (Los Angeles), The Performer’s Academy (OC) and Wingspan Arts, (NYC). Randi has shared the stage with a wide range of artists, including Pat Benatar, Dar Williams, Bruce Hornsby, Bonnie Raitt, Anthony Rapp (Rent), Max Von Essen (An American in Paris), Jason Mraz, and Dave Koz.

Randi’s original song “What Matters” has been featured in several stage productions, films and documentaries, and proceeds from the song support the Matthew Shepard Foundation, an anti-hate charity. The choral version of Randi’s song has been performed by over fifty choirs internationally, and has been featured at New York’s Carnegie Hall and the Disney Hall in California. A film about the making of Randi’s song “What Matters” has earned several awards and the song itself was named one of the top Pride Anthems, by the Advocate Magazine. In February of 2019, Randi’s original song, Happy Hour in Heaven won “The Love Song Contest” at Betty Lou’s Lounge, Antioch, TN. Later that same year,”Randi won Nashville’s Top Writer Series contest. Other accolades include, Best Adult Contemporary award in the Song of the Year contest, 2012, Campus Activities Female Perfomer of the Year 2004, Creative Planet “Voice” award, 2012, Matthew Shepard Foundation’s “Essential Piece” award recipient, 2005, and numerous San Diego Music Award nominations. 

Randi has released seven studio albums and has participated in or performed on, over fifty more, for various artists and bands, of varying genres. Randi’s first solo release, “Climb” on East River Records, was recorded at Studio West and produced by Jon Mathias. Since that time, Randi’s cds have been released independently, on her own label, Dramatique Records.

Randi tours year round, solo or with her musical partner, Noah Heldman, performing her original music. Randi’s 2015 release, “Glass Slipper” was produced by Noah Heldman and Grammy winner Larry Mitchell. “Glass Slipper” features a duet with People Magazine’s up and coming country artist, Aaron Parker, and a wide range of musical guests, including Grammy award winning cellist, Dave Eggar. Randi currently resides in Nashville TN, where she is working on her upcoming release with producer, Dean Miller. When Randi is not on tour, she can be found teaching music & theatre, crockpotting, cosuming large amounts of coffee, and cuddling with her family.

Williams was a teenager when he opened for R&B acts Lakeside and Al Green along with gospel legend Shirley Caesar. After studying jazz at San Diego State University, Williams went from regular gigs backing many of San Diego’s most prominent homegrown talent to the neon lights of the Las Vegas strip where he accompanied such nationally-renowned headliners as Clint Holmes, Angela Bofill, Tevin Campbell, Howard Hewett and Keith Washington, and did a road stint with Chaka Khan. After moving back to California in 2008, Williams dropped his debut album, “That Was Then,” garnering praise from JazzTimes and national airplay on SiriusXM. He has become a fixture on the smooth/contemporary jazz scene where he has shared the stage with the genre’s heavy hitters: Richard Elliot, Peter White, Gerald Albright, Mindi Abair, Brenda Russell, Darren Rahn, Jessy J, Everette Harp and Jeff Kashiwa. He has also recorded with Jackiem Joyner, Blake Aaron, Nils Jiptner, U-Nam and Kay-Ta Matsuno.

Introducing Tony Exum Jr., the sensational saxophonist blending Contemporary Jazz, R&B, and Funk into an unforgettable musical experience. With a smooth and soulful sound that resonates deeply, Tony has carved out a unique niche in the music world. 

His rise to international acclaim began in 2019 with the release of his captivating single “My Name’s Tony,” which not only captured hearts but also secured a remarkable 12-week run on the Smooth Jazz Network’s top 100 chart. With performances that have graced esteemed festivals and venues like the Middle C Jazz in Charlotte, San Diego Smooth Jazz Festival, Winter Park Jazz Festival, and Myrtle Beach Jazz Festival, Boscov’s Berks Jazz Festival Tony’s artistry knows no bounds. 

Beyond his electrifying performances, he lends his voice five nights a week to Jazz 93.5 FM, where he curates the airwaves with the latest in contemporary jazz, showcasing his passion for the genre. Additionally, as a Global Brand Ambassador for Kastell Vodka, he exemplifies the seamless fusion of music and lifestyle. 

Tony’s artistic journey is adorned with two critically acclaimed albums, “Finally” and “The One,” alongside a collection of seven singles, including the chart-hitting gems “Brighter Days” and “Get At You.” In 2022, he took a significant step forward by signing with Sony/The Orchard/BSE Recordings, releasing “Everything,” which soared to #19 on the Urban Influencer R&B Soul Chart. His latest offerings include the chart-topping “Hold My Hand,” which reached an impressive #1 on the Urban Influencer Radio Airplay Experts Smooth Jazz chart and his latest “Mr. S A X” featuring Teri Tobin currently in the top 20 Urban Influencer Smooth Jazz Chart and reaching the Smooth Jazz Spain top 100 peaking at #26 as well as Allen Kepler’s Smooth Jazz Network top 100.

Adding to his accolades, Tony is featured on the 2024 released track “I Wanna Be Closer”  (originally recorded by the 70s Motown group Switch) by R&B Legend Glenn Jones featuring Eric Nolan of the O’Jays which debuted at #1 on the Amazon R&B UK Charts, reached #1 for two weeks on the Urban Influencer R&B/Soul and garnered an 2024 Indie Soul Awards nomination. As he prepares for his upcoming tour for 2025, with performances lined up in vibrant locales like North Carolina, California, Houston, Denver, and Dallas, the excitement surrounding his music continues to grow. 

Tony has shared the stage with a who’s who of R&B/Soul and Contemporary Jazz talent including  Billboard #1 Smooth Jazz artists’ Adam Hawley, Julian Vaughn, Lin Rountree,  Elan Trotman, Najee and the late Nick Colionne to R&B stalwarts like 90s sensations Shai, Surface, Donell Jones, Ginuwine, Adina Howard, Howard Hewitt just to name to a very small few.
